Understanding Jack Screw Flanges: Types and Applications

Jack screw flanges are essential components in various industries, particularly in construction and machinery. These flanges allow for precise adjustments and holding of heavy equipment. Understanding the types and applications of jack screw flanges can greatly enhance operational efficiency.

There are several types of jack screw flanges. For instance, some have fixed adjustments, while others are designed for variable settings. This variability can be crucial in applications where load-bearing requirements change frequently. In construction, a jack screw flange might support a temporary structure. In a factory, they could secure machinery in place. Each scenario demands a different type of flange.

When choosing a jack screw flange, consider the material and load capacity. Steel is common for its strength, but it may rust over time. Stainless steel offers better corrosion resistance but at a higher cost. Sometimes, users opt for lower-grade materials to save money, which may lead to issues later. Always evaluate the specific needs of your project before making a decision. Small details can lead to significant impacts. It’s essential to reflect on your choices to ensure the right application.

Key Factors to Consider When Choosing Jack Screw Flanges

When selecting jack screw flanges, several key factors require attention. The material is critical. Stainless steel offers durability and resistance to corrosion. However, some applications might demand different materials. For instance, plastic flanges are lighter but can be less robust. Weight is often an overlooked aspect. Heavier flanges can provide better stability, but they may complicate installation.

Another essential factor is the size and compatibility. Measure dimensions carefully to ensure an accurate fit. Larger flanges can accommodate more substantial loads, but they may not fit all configurations. Pay attention to the load capacity as well. Some flanges handle more pressure than others.

Lastly, surface finish is worth considering. A rough finish can increase resistance but may affect sealing capabilities. Think about the environment where the flange will be used. This will inform decisions on sealing methods and maintenance. There is always a balance between functionality and cost. It's important to reflect on these choices, as the wrong flange could lead to unexpected failures or repairs.

Installation Guidelines for Jack Screw Flanges

When installing jack screw flanges, attention to detail is crucial. Ensure that the flange surface is clean and free of debris. Any contaminants can compromise the seal. Using a soft brush or cloth can effectively remove dust and dirt.

Choosing the right flange size is essential. Flanges should match the piping dimensions closely. Mismatched sizes can lead to leaks or failure. Always verify measurements before installation.

Follow the manufacturer's guidelines for assembly. This includes proper torque settings for screws. Over-tightening can damage the flange. Under-tightening can lead to disastrous leaks. It’s a delicate balance. Consider using a torque wrench for accuracy. Safety should always come first during this process.

Maintenance Tips for Long-lasting Jack Screw Flanges

When it comes to jack screw flanges, proper maintenance is key to ensuring their longevity. Regular inspections can reveal wear and tear that may compromise their performance. Look for signs of corrosion or deformation. These issues, if ignored, can lead to costly repairs. Keep a maintenance log to track servicing. This helps identify patterns and potential failures.

Lubrication is another crucial aspect. Use appropriate lubricants to reduce friction and prevent wear. However, don't overdo it. Excess lubricant can attract dirt and grime. Clean the flange surfaces regularly; this minimizes contaminants that may cause damage. Monitor the torque settings periodically, as they can change over time. Incorrect settings can lead to uneven pressure and ultimately, flange failure.

Remember, jack screw flanges also need proper storage. When not in use, store them in a dry, clean environment. This limits exposure to moisture and chemicals. Glass-Bead Blasting

Abrasive media blasting is an excellent way to remove old paint, rust, and increase the paint/powder adhesion. Glass beads produce a much smoother and brighter finish than angular abrasives; leaving the part clean yet without any dimensional change. Chemically inert and environmentally friendly, we can recycle our beads approximately 30 times; making them a more preferred method of metal cleaning or surface finishing.

Advantages to Glass Bead Blasting are many. Glass bead blast media is used when a project is needing rough surfaces need to become smooth for applications of coatings such as paint. It is typically used to clean paint and rust from a product surface without deforming the surface it is being used on. Screen Printing

Screen printing is a photographic process that transfers artwork onto a porous nylon screen which allows colored ink to flow through the screen and be deposited on an aluminum or plastic component. We can generally have just about any design created onto a screen for your parts.
